Im trying to set index.php file in my html folder as localhost:5555 and my second index.php file in html/highlighter folder as localhost:5555/highlighter with first everything okay, but with second one not, when i go to localhost:5555/highlighter it prints 404 Not Found
Can you help me?
My folders tree:
nginx │ ├── html │ ├── 50x.html │ ├── highlight │ │ ├── functions.php │ │ ├── icon.png │ │ ├── index.css │ │ ├── index.php │ └── index.php ├── nginx.exe
nginx.conf
worker_processes 1;
events {
worker_connections 1024;
}
http {
include mime.types;
default_type application/octet-stream;
sendfile on;
server {
listen 5555;
server_name localhost;
location / {
root html;
index index.php;
}
location /highlighter {
root html/highlight;
index index.php;
}
location ~ .php$ {
fastcgi_pass 127.0.0.1:9123;
fastcgi_index index.php;
fastcgi_param SCRIPT_FILENAME $document_root$fastcgi_script_name;
include fastcgi_params;
}
error_page 500 502 503 504 /50x.html;
location = /50x.html {
root html;
}
}
}
UPDATE
My mistake was adding 2 roots in location blocks, if you have same error, try move root from location block like this
worker_processes 1;
events {
worker_connections 1024;
}
http {
include mime.types;
default_type application/octet-stream;
sendfile on;
keepalive_timeout 65;
server {
listen 5555;
server_name localhost;
root "D:\Miscellaneous\nginxSites";
location / {
index index.php;
}
location /highlighter {
index index.php;
}
location ~ .php$ {
fastcgi_pass 127.0.0.1:9123;
fastcgi_index index.php;
fastcgi_param SCRIPT_FILENAME $document_root$fastcgi_script_name;
include fastcgi_params;
}
error_page 500 502 503 504 /50x.html;
location = /50x.html {
root html;
}
}
}

Answer
You can try the following approach:
location /highlighter {
alias /var/www/html/highlighter/;
index index.php index.html;
#try_files $uri $uri/ =404;
try_files $uri $uri/ /highlighter/index.php;
}
